L'evolució de la física es un libro escrito por Albert Einstein y Leopold Infeld, publicado por Edicions 62 en 1984. Este libro explora la evolución de los conceptos físicos a lo largo de la historia, desde la mecánica clásica hasta la teoría de la relatividad y la física cuántica. Escrito en catalán, el libro ofrece una visión accesible de los principios fundamentales que rigen el universo, dirigido a un público general interesado en la ciencia.

Albert Einstein was a German-born theoretical physicist best known for developing the known theory of relativity. Einstein also made important contributions to quantum theory. His mass–energy equivalence formula E = mc2, which arises from special relativity, has been called "the world's most famous equation". He received the 1921 Nobel Prize in Physics for "his services to theoretical physics, and especially for his discovery of the law of the photoelectric effect".
